Tonight's mouth-watering Evo-Stik Division One South clash between Coalville Town and King's Lynn Town has been postponed because of a frozen pitch.
The Linnets, third, were set to visit the league leaders this evening but a pitch inspection at 12.30pm has put paid to any hopes of playing the clash in Leicestershire.
It's the second time this season that the planned fixture at Owen Street has been called off due to the weather.
Lynn are set to return to action on Saturday at home to play-off chasing Leek Town.
